The below graph shows the average semi-detached house price in the Reigate and Banstead local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The three 10 CORNFIELD ROAD sales between November 2001 and September 2016 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the October 2010 sale was for 33%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 33% above the HPI over time, until the September 2016 sale, where it rises to 64% above the HPI. The line then continues to track at 64% above the HPI.
